About

Xianan Li is a scholar working on Molecular Biology, Oncology and Pulmonary and Respiratory Medicine. According to data from OpenAlex, Xianan Li has authored 44 papers receiving a total of 506 indexed citations (citations by other indexed papers that have themselves been cited), including 15 papers in Molecular Biology, 14 papers in Oncology and 10 papers in Pulmonary and Respiratory Medicine. Recurrent topics in Xianan Li's work include Sarcoma Diagnosis and Treatment (9 papers), Nanoplatforms for cancer theranostics (6 papers) and Peptidase Inhibition and Analysis (4 papers). Xianan Li is often cited by papers focused on Sarcoma Diagnosis and Treatment (9 papers), Nanoplatforms for cancer theranostics (6 papers) and Peptidase Inhibition and Analysis (4 papers). Xianan Li collaborates with scholars based in China, United States and Australia. Xianan Li's co-authors include Zhengxiao Ouyang, Zanjing Zhai, Xuqiang Liu, Hongwei Wu, Gang Huang, Yi Luo, Haowei Li, Yang Shen, Xinhua Qu and Qiming Fan and has published in prestigious journals such as Journal of Clinical Oncology, SHILAP Revista de lepidopterología and Biomaterials.
